The approach used to calculate litres depends on the shape of the aquarium. Most tanks fall into a few standard geometric categories.
To make calculations simple, the universal conversion element to remember is:1 cubic centimetre (₤ cm ^ 3 ₤) = 0.001 litres (or 1,000 cubic centimetres = 1 litre).
Additionally, when measuring in centimetres, the standard formula for rectangular tanks is:₤ ₤ \ text Volume in Litres = \ frac \ text Length (cm) \ times \ text Width (cm) \ times \ text Height (cm) 1,000 ₤ ₤
1. Rectangle-shaped Aquariums
Rectangular tanks are the most common type discovered in homes. To find the volume, measure the interior length, width, and height in centimetres.
Formula: ₤ \ text Length \ times \ text Width \ times \ text Height/ 1,000 ₤Example: A tank measuring 100 cm long, 40 cm wide, and 50 cm high:₤ ₤ \ frac 100 \ times 40 \ times 50 1,000 = \ frac 200,000 1,000 = 200 \ text Litres ₤ ₤2. Cylindrical (Round) Aquariums
Round tanks require a somewhat different formula due to the fact that of their circular base, counting on pi (₤ \ pi \ approx 3.1416 ₤).
Formula: ₤ \ pi \ times \ text Radius ^ 2 \ times \ text Height/ 1,000 ₤ ( Note: Radius is half of the diameter).Example: A cylinder with a size of 50 cm (Radius = 25 cm) and a height of 60 cm:₤ ₤ 3.1416 \ times 25 ^ 2 \ times 60/ 1,000 = 3.1416 \ times 625 \ times 60/ 1,000 = 117.8 \ text Litres ₤ ₤3. Bow-Front Aquariums
Bow-front tanks feature a curved front glass that expands the viewing area. Because calculating the precise volume of the bow can be complex, aquarists typically use a customized rectangular formula.
Method: Measure the width from the side (at the narrowest point) and the width at the widest point of the bow. Average the 2 widths together, then treat the tank as a basic rectangle.Quick Reference Conversion Table

One common error newbies make is presuming that a 200-litre tank holds 200 litres of water. In truth, it holds less. This discrepancy is because of displacement.
Every things positioned inside the aquarium presses water out of the method. For that reason, the actual water volume is lower than the calculated glass volume. Aspects that decrease total water volume consist of:
Substrate: Gravel, sand, or aqusoil layers use up significant space at the bottom of the tank.Hardscape: Large driftwood pieces, rocks, and slate developments displace water.Decorations: Artificial ornaments, caves, and background structures lower capacity.Devices: Internal filters, heating systems, and air stones consume small quantities of space.Unfilled Space: Most tanks are not filled right to the very leading; water sits a centimetre or more below the plastic rim.How to Estimate Displacement
While calculating the exact displacement of every rock and pebble is laborious, aquarists can generally estimate that decorations, substrate, and empty space reduce total tank volume by approximately 10% to 15%.
For example, a tank determined geometrically to hold 200 litres will likely hold closer to 175 to 180 litres of real water once totally decorated. When dosing powerful medications, it is always much safer to Calculate Litres In Fish Tank based upon this slightly reduced water volume to prevent unintentional overdosing.
